Fullstack Software Engineer - Connected Devices
Martin System® · Liège
Job description
About the role
We are seeking a Fullstack Software Engineer to develop and maintain a connected‑device platform used in education. The role blends mobile development, BLE communication, backend integration, and cloud services to deliver a seamless user experience.
Key responsibilities
- Design and implement a React Native / TypeScript mobile app that interacts with BLE devices.
- Contribute native code for Android and iOS when required.
- Integrate the app with Firebase and Google Cloud Platform services for data storage, authentication, firmware updates, and notifications.
- Manage device state, support user workflows, and ensure reliable cross‑platform performance.
- Collaborate with product, hardware, support, and business teams to deliver a cohesive ecosystem.
Required profile
- Strong engineering mindset with interest in mobile architecture, state management, and IoT.
- Experience or enthusiasm for React Native, React, and TypeScript.
- Understanding of security fundamentals and cloud‑backed applications.
- Ability to work with diverse stakeholders across product, hardware, and support.
Required skills
- React Native
- TypeScript
- BLE (Bluetooth Low Energy)
- iOS development
- Android development
- Firebase (Firestore, Cloud Messaging)
- Google Cloud Platform
What we offer
- Opportunity to work on a real connected‑device ecosystem with educational impact.
- Cross‑domain learning across mobile, backend, cloud, and hardware.
- Growth as an engineer in a product‑focused environment.
Questions fréquentes
Why are you reporting this job?
Apply in 30 seconds
Enter your email to apply. An account will be created automatically.
By continuing, you accept our terms of use.
Already have an account? Login
Published 10 uur geleden
Expires over 1 maand
8 views · 0 interested
Boost your chances
Upload your CV — we will match you with relevant openings.
Analyzing your CV...
Martin System®
Liège
Related job offers
-
Software Engineer – Game Studio
GAMING1 Liège -
Analyste‑Programmeur·euse .NET / C# – Hub d’intégration
TRENDY FOODS Liège -
Solutions Architect – Gaming Technology
GAMING1 Liège -
Praktijklector ICT & Data (95% opdracht)
UCLL Advanced business management Banaba Heverlee -
Cybersecurity Technical Business Development Manager – Brussels
Cipherbit-Grupo Oesía Bruxelles